1 | SENATE RESOLUTION
| ||||||
2 | WHEREAS, The members of the Illinois Senate are saddened to | ||||||
3 | learn of the death of Dr. Joseph Matthew Saban of Lakewood, who | ||||||
4 | passed away on September 29, 2017; and
| ||||||
5 | WHEREAS, Joe Saban was born in South Elgin to Joseph and | ||||||
6 | Dragica (Stilinovic) Saban on December 31, 1946; and
| ||||||
7 | WHEREAS, Joe Saban began his career in education, teaching | ||||||
8 | science to junior high and then high school students; after | ||||||
9 | several years of teaching, he transitioned to the position of | ||||||
10 | Assistant Superintendent in Charge of Finance at District 155 | ||||||
11 | in Crystal Lake; he later became Superintendent of Schools for | ||||||
12 | the district and earned his Doctorate of Education; during his | ||||||
13 | tenure, he facilitated the building of Prairie Ridge High | ||||||
14 | School; after retiring from District 155, he became a Professor | ||||||
15 | at Northern Illinois University, where he trained masters and | ||||||
16 | doctoral students in educational leadership; and
